Lance Cpl. Adam Chaffee, a mortarman with Weapons Company, 1st Battalion, 25th Marine Regiment, and a native of Charlestown, N.H., watches the sun set while manning a post at Patrol Base Boldak, Helmand province, Oct. 3. Boldak is the first line of defense for Camp Leatherneck, the largest coalition base in Helmand province. It is manned by Weapons Co., 1st Bn., 25th Marines, a reservist unit based out of Fort Devens, Mass. - Lance Cpl.
